Class Description

Discover the timeless art of block printing in this fun, hands-on class with artist Anastasia Zielinski. You'll learn how to design, carve, and print your own linoleum block, exploring the creative use of positive and negative space to produce bold, dramatic images. Once your block is carved, you'll use it to create a series of beautiful handmade prints or greeting cards that can be reproduced again and again. Please bring a simple design or photograph to work from, and Anastasia will help you choose the best elements to create a successful print. This class is suitable for beginners and anyone interested in exploring the art of printmaking. All carving and printing supplies are provided.
